Frequently Asked Questions
What is the average MOT pass rate for a Benelli Leoncino 500?
The Benelli Leoncino 500 has an average 93.5% MOT pass rate across model years 2017 to 2020, based on DVSA test data.
What are the most common MOT failures on a Benelli Leoncino 500?
The most common MOT failure reasons for the Benelli Leoncino 500 across all years are: rate of flashing not between 60 and 120 times per minute, a transmission belt, chain, sprocket or pulley so loose or worn it is likely to fail, a rear registration plate lamp or light source missing or inoperative in the case of a single lamp or all lamps. These are typical wear items that can often be checked and addressed before your test.
